Influence of carbon source on the microstructure of Al-Ti-C master alloy and its grain refining efficiency

A new kind of Al-5Ti-0.3C master alloy with a uniform microstructure was prepared by using Al-5C alloy as a carbon source in this study. In the master alloy, TiC particles exhibit hexagonal platelet and macroporous morphologies, distributing homogeneously in the aluminum matrix. It is supposed that TiC particles are synthesized by the reaction between dissolved Ti and Al4C3. The grain refining performance of the master alloy on commercial pure aluminum was investigated. The average grain size of α-Al can be reduced from 3300 μm to 178 μm with the addition of 0.2 wt.% of the prepared Al-5Ti-0.3C master alloy. Besides, the grain refining efficiency is stable and does not fade within 30 min.
